To configure the access point as a DHCP server

1. From the menu, click TCP/IP Settings. The TCP/IP Settings screen

appears.

2. Verify that the IP Address field, IP Subnet Mask field, and IP Router

field are configured. For help, see “Configuring the TCP/IP Settings” on
page 65.

3. Configure the DHCP parameters to make this access point a DHCP

server. For help, see the next table.

Table 15. DHCP Server Parameter Descriptions

Parameter

Explanation

DHCP Mode

Choose This AP is a DHCP Server. The access
point must have a valid IP address and subnet
mask.

DHCP Server
Name

Enter the name for this access point as a DHCP
server.
